Costco liquidation pallets present a unique opportunity for savvy shoppers to score incredible savings. These pallets, often containing surplus or slightly damaged merchandise, are sold at deeply reduced prices, offering substantial value compared to regular retail. Whether you're a seasoned bargain hunter or simply looking for a way to stretch your budget, exploring Costco liquidation pallets can be a rewarding experience.
The intrigue of sifting through these pallets lies in the element of treasure hunt. You never know exactly what you'll find, which adds an extra layer of excitement to the process. From home goods and electronics to clothing and groceries, there's a wide range of potential treasures waiting to be uncovered.
- Prior to you embark on your Costco liquidation pallet adventure, it's essential to understand with the process and set realistic expectations.
- Become acquainted yourself with the different types of pallets available, as well as their potential contents.
- Scrutinize items carefully for any damage or defects before making a purchase.
Bear this in mind that Costco liquidation pallets are sold as is, so there are usually no returns or exchanges.
